Het omgaan met de Python-fout oxzep7 kan behoorlijk frustrerend zijn, omdat deze vaak uit het niets opduikt. Meestal wordt het veroorzaakt door een fout in de Python-installatie, ontbrekende afhankelijkheden of omgevingsvariabelen die overal verspreid staan. Als je dit bent tegengekomen, is het de moeite waard om een aantal stappen te doorlopen om te proberen het op te lossen in plaats van alles blindelings opnieuw te installeren. Soms lost het probleem zich op bij de ene installatie door opnieuw op te starten en te updaten; bij een andere installatie blijft het gewoon terugkomen. Omdat Windows graag dingen ingewikkeld maakt, hebben deze fouten meestal meer te maken met eigenaardigheden in de omgeving dan met iets wat echt kapot is. Dus hier is een redelijk verstandige lijst met dingen om te controleren of te proberen.
Hoe los ik de Python-fout oxzep7-software op?
Werk Python en pip bij — het is de moeite waard om te proberen als uw versies verouderd zijn
Controleer eerst je Python-versie met python –version. Als het niet de nieuwste versie is, download dan de nieuwste versie van python.org. In sommige configuraties kunnen oude versies vreemde fouten of incompatibiliteiten veroorzaken, vooral met nieuwere pakketten. Upgrade ook pip: run pip install --upgrade pip
. Dit helpt vaak bij het oplossen van afhankelijkheden en zorgt ervoor dat je tools up-to-date zijn (omdat Python het natuurlijk moeilijker moet maken dan nodig is).
Installeer de pakketten die problemen veroorzaken opnieuw
Als de fout wijst op specifieke modules die kapot lijken, installeer ze dan opnieuw met pip install --force-reinstall package_name
. Bij sommige installaties worden kapotte links of corrupte bestanden hiermee hersteld. Als u werkt vanuit een requirements.txt, voert u de installatie gewoon pip install -r requirements.txt
opnieuw uit. Soms raken afhankelijkheden door elkaar, en een schone herinstallatie lost de problemen op.
Herstel de daadwerkelijke software-installatie
Er gebeuren vreemde dingen wanneer de belangrijkste app-bestanden beschadigd raken, bijvoorbeeld door een onderbroken installatie of onbedoelde verwijdering. Om dit te verhelpen, verwijdert u de software via Configuratiescherm > Programma’s of Instellingen > Apps en onderdelen. Verwijder vervolgens de overgebleven mappen in AppData\Local en AppData\Roaming die relevant zijn voor Python of de app. Installeer opnieuw met beheerdersrechten (klik met de rechtermuisknop op het installatieprogramma en kies Als administrator uitvoeren ).Soms lost een nieuwe installatie fouten op die er ogenschijnlijk niets mee te maken hadden.
Controleer omgevingsvariabelen – ze zijn vaak de oorzaak van problemen
Klik in Windows met de rechtermuisknop op Start > Systeem en ga vervolgens naar Geavanceerde systeeminstellingen > Omgevingsvariabelen. Zoek de variabele Pad onder Systeemvariabelen. Zorg ervoor dat deze paden bevat zoals:
C:\Users\YourUser\AppData\Local\Programs\Python\Python311\ C:\Users\YourUser\AppData\Local\Programs\Python\Python311\Scripts\
Als deze er niet in staan, wordt Python niet gevonden wanneer je het vanaf de opdrachtregel aanroept, wat tot fouten leidt. Het corrigeren of toevoegen van de juiste paden kan een game changer zijn, vooral wanneer Windows koppig weigert Python correct te vinden.
Scripts of de app uitvoeren als beheerder
Soms is een gebrek aan rechten de reden dat dingen mislukken. Klik met de rechtermuisknop op het Python-script of de app die je wilt uitvoeren en selecteer Als administrator uitvoeren. Ik weet niet zeker waarom dit helpt, maar in sommige configuraties kan dit problemen met rechten oplossen die de toegang tot bepaalde bestanden of mappen blokkeren, vooral als de app naar beveiligde mappen moet schrijven. Op de ene machine werkte het meteen, op de andere minder, maar het is een snelle oplossing om te proberen.
Stel een virtuele omgeving in – houd afhankelijkheden overzichtelijk
Virtuele omgevingen zijn waarschijnlijk de beste manier om conflicten te vermijden die fouten zoals oxzep7 veroorzaken. Maak een nieuwe omgeving aan met python -m venv venv
. Activeer deze via venv\Scripts\activate
(op Windows) en installeer vervolgens alleen wat je nodig hebt. Omdat afhankelijkheden wereldwijd door elkaar kunnen raken, kan het isoleren van je project een hoop gepieker en mislukte installaties besparen. Ik weet niet zeker waarom het werkt, maar bij sommige projecten houdt het alles gewoon netjes.
Veelgestelde vragen
In principe gaat het meestal om een kapotte installatie, ontbrekende modules of omgevingsvariabelen die door elkaar zijn geraakt. Het is niet per se een Python-bug, maar meer de manier waarop de software met je huidige configuratie samenwerkt.
Niet echt een bug in Python zelf. Het gaat er meer om dat de software niet goed werkt zonder de juiste omgeving of afhankelijkheden. Dit gebeurt vaak wanneer de installatie corrupt raakt of paden niet kloppen.
Soms. Het repareren van omgevingsvariabelen, het opnieuw installeren van een paar specifieke pakketten of het repareren van de app zelf kan de oplossing zijn. Een volledige herinstallatie is niet nodig als je het probleem vroeg opmerkt.
Nee, alleen als de fout met rechten te maken heeft. Als het gaat om ontbrekende afhankelijkheden of padproblemen, helpt dat niet. Maar het is vaak toch het proberen waard – snel en eenvoudig.
Zeker. Ze zijn geweldig in het gescheiden houden van afhankelijkheden, waardoor je de gebruikelijke conflicten vermijdt die dit soort fouten veroorzaken.
Als oxzep7 na deze stappen blijft haperen, is het waarschijnlijk tijd om de omgevingspaden te controleren, problematische pakketten opnieuw te installeren en misschien zelfs een schone herinstallatie van Python of de app uit te voeren. Doorgaans helpt het om in die volgorde configuratieproblemen, defecte afhankelijkheden en machtigingsproblemen één voor één op te lossen.